S. Brandl is a scholar working on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Astronomy and Astrophysics. According to data from OpenAlex, S. Brandl has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 333 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, 11 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 6 papers in Astronomy and Astrophysics. Recurrent topics in S. Brandl's work include Semiconductor Quantum Structures and Devices (11 papers), Superconducting and THz Device Technology (6 papers) and Terahertz technology and applications (5 papers). S. Brandl is often cited by papers focused on Semiconductor Quantum Structures and Devices (11 papers), Superconducting and THz Device Technology (6 papers) and Terahertz technology and applications (5 papers). S. Brandl collaborates with scholars based in Germany, Russia and United Kingdom. S. Brandl's co-authors include K. F. Renk, E. Schomburg, V. M. Ustinov, A. E. Zhukov, D. G. Pavel’ev, Yu. Koschurinov, Andreas Mühlberger, Stefan Wüst, Julia Diemer and Youssef Shiban and has published in prestigious journals such as Physical review. B, Condensed matter, Applied Physics Letters and Physics Letters A.
